XSS (Cross-Site Scripting) is a type of security vulnerability that allows attackers to inject malicious scripts into web pages viewed by other users. This can lead to a wide range of harmful consequences, including stealing sensitive information, hijacking user sessions, defacing websites, spreading malware, and more.
The impact of XSS vulnerabilities can be significant for both users and website owners. For users, XSS attacks can result in their personal information being compromised, such as login credentials, financial details, or other sensitive data. Attackers can use this information for identity theft, fraud, or other malicious activities.
For website owners, XSS vulnerabilities can damage their reputation, lead to loss of customer trust, and result in legal consequences. If attackers exploit XSS vulnerabilities on a website, they can perform various actions on behalf of legitimate users, such as changing account settings, posting unauthorized content, or redirecting users to malicious websites.
Furthermore, XSS attacks can also have broader implications for the overall security of the internet. By exploiting XSS vulnerabilities, attackers can compromise not only individual websites but also entire networks and systems. This can create a ripple effect, impacting multiple users, organizations, and even critical infrastructure.
In conclusion, XSS vulnerabilities pose a serious threat to the security and integrity of web applications and the internet as a whole. It is crucial for website owners to implement proper security measures, such as input validation, output encoding, and content security policies, to mitigate the risk of XSS attacks and protect both users and their own assets.